European Reform and the EU's respect for Democracy

How it works, no.1...

Macron (a month before becoming French President):

- "Germany benefits from the imbalances within the Eurozone and achieves very high trade surpluses."
"Those aren't a good thing either for Germany or for the economy of the Eurozone."
"There should be a rebalancing."


Martin Schulz (Merkel's rival for Chancellor and ex-President of the European Parliament):

- "In light of the presidential campaign in France and the debates led during the campaign, let me stress this: I regard the criticism of our high trade surplus as wrong. "
"We don't need to feel ashamed of being successful. "
"Our exports are the result of good work done here in the country.”


Angela Merkel :

"...the large surplus is linked to the quality of our products”.

The Chancellor added:

"Another part of it is linked to the policies of the European Central Bank which we can't influence."
"Wage increases are now exceeding productivity growth and if you look at the forecasts, the surplus will fall slightly in coming years."

European Reform and the EU's respect for Democracy

How it works, no.2...

Macron (before becoming French President):

- He proposed implementing EU-wide protectionist measures, hailed ‘Macronomics’, which he hopes will reinvent trading with the bloc.

Mr Macron: “Globalization is a tough fight because not everyone always respects the rules."
“So we will turn the protection of European industry into one of the major pillars of reinventing the EU.”


He also proposed a "Buy European Act".
The act is one of pro-EU Macron’s key policies and it would restrict access to public procurement contracts in Brussels, such as rail and infrastructure projects, to only companies that have at least half of their product inside the bloc.



Jyrki Katainen - (European Commission vice president for jobs, growth, investment and competitiveness since 2014. ):

- “I strongly believe that Europeans are capable of providing services and goods that fulfil the expectations of European consumers without any artificial rules, which would force people or local authorities to only buy European products without a reason.”

France’s multinational rail company Alstom has said Europe is too open to Asian companies in big public rail contracts, than Asian companies are to EU companies.

- The Finnish commissioner said that the EU as a whole can’t afford to restrict pubic procurement, but there should be a global public procurement system.
He said:
“When I listen to what Emmanuel Macron said during the campaign, he seemed to have been a very active shaper of globalisation instead of building walls around France, so I expect that France will be a strong influencer.”
